Sapphiré: Sapphira, a Christian woman Original Word: Σαπφείρη, ης, ἡ Part of Speech: Noun, Feminine Transliteration: Sapphiré Phonetic Spelling: (sap-fi'-ray) Short Definition: Sapphira Definition: Sapphira, wife of Ananias, an early Christian.

Feminine of sappheiros; Sapphire, an Israelitess -- Sapphira. see GREEK sappheiros
